§ 326. Erection and discontinuance of pounds. Whenever the electors of\nany town shall determine at a biennial town election to erect one or\nmore pounds therein, and whenever a pound shall now be erected in any\ntown, the same shall be kept under the care and direction of a\npound-master, to be appointed for that purpose. The electors of any town\nmay, at a biennial town election, discontinue any pounds therein.\n
